Wen Tang has authored 28 papers that have received a total of 1.4k indexed citations.
This includes 11 papers in Materials Chemistry, 11 papers in Biomedical Engineering and 11 papers in Organic Chemistry. The topics of these papers are Chemical Synthesis and Analysis (6 papers), Nanoplatforms for cancer theranostics (6 papers) and Supramolecular Self-Assembly in Materials (4 papers). Wen Tang is often cited by papers focused on Chemical Synthesis and Analysis (6 papers), Nanoplatforms for cancer theranostics (6 papers) and Supramolecular Self-Assembly in Materials (4 papers) and coll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Hong Kong. Wen Tang's co-authors include Lihong Jing, Matthew L. Becker, Kevin J. McHugh, Chrys Wesdemiotis and Kan Yue and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, Journal of the American Chemical Society and Chemical Society Reviews.
